1986 Ford Meteor vs. 2010 Citroen C3

To start off, 2010 Citroen C3 is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Ford Meteor.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Ford Meteor would be higher. At 1,596 cc (4 cylinders), 1986 Ford Meteor is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1986 Ford Meteor (71 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 4 more horse power than 2010 Citroen C3. (67 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1986 Ford Meteor should accelerate faster than 2010 Citroen C3.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Citroen C3 (161 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 40 more torque (in Nm) than 1986 Ford Meteor. (121 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2010 Citroen C3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1986 Ford Meteor. 2010 Citroen C3 has automatic transmission and 1986 Ford Meteor has manual transmission. 1986 Ford Meteor will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2010 Citroen C3 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
